ROM Changes

 At the November meeting of the BTCA Board the ROM point system was again discussed at length.  It was decided, in response to input from the membership and guidance from the Special Awards Review Committee, to make the following changes to the ROM point system.

 

1.        ROM show status will continue to be approved by the Board in advance.  There will not be a pre-designated number of ROM points assigned to a particular show.  Any ROM designated show has the potential of a maximum of 3 points, dependent on meeting entry-qualifying numbers.  There will be no “stand alone” ROM shows.  All ROM designated shows not meeting the entry requirements for 3 ROM point status, will be by default eligible for 2 ROM point status, subject to the requirements of 2 point status.

 

2.        Qualifications for 3 point ROM status are as follows:

30 dogs total entry (colored and whites combined)

8 dogs of each sex and variety (i.e. 6 class dogs and 2 specials – technically 6 dogs in classes for Winners to get Winners ROM points and 2 additional entries, either class dogs or specials of the same sex, to qualify for BOV or BOS ROM points)

These are the minimum requirements.  The other rules, which apply, remain the same.  If there are insufficient dogs but sufficient bitches (subject to the 30 dog total) and the dog beats the bitch, then the dog qualifies for the same points as the bitch (or vice versa).  This also includes the provision for BOW beating BOS and qualifying for the same points as BOS.

 

3.        Qualifications for 2 point ROM status.

All other ROM designated shows will be eligible for 2 point ROM subject to the following criteria.

6 dogs of each sex and variety ( i.e. 5 class dogs and 1 special – technically 5 dogs in classes for Winners to get Winners ROM points and an additional entry, either a class dog or special of the same sex, to qualify for BOV or BOS ROM points).  Again, should there be insufficient entries in dogs and sufficient entries in bitches and the dog beats the bitch, then it qualifies for the same points as the bitch (or vice versa).

4.   In addition, the two minimum 3 pt. wins must be under different judges and on different
      weekends, as well as gaining the usual 10 ROM points.

 It is hoped these changes will give additional incentive for participation as well as increased opportunities to earn 3 ROM points. The situation will be closely monitored, and should these changes prove detrimental, the Board will revisit this situation in light of the additional developments.  The desire is to continue to develop a system which rewards dogs appropriately, without incurring undo hardship on the show going members in order to qualify for this award.

 

The Board initially agreed to implement these rules starting January 1, 2002.  Since there has been no vehicle for “official” notification of the membership, the Board has voted to delay total implementation of these rules until February 1, 2002.   For the shows in January 2002, whichever set of rules, these for 2002 or the previous rules for 2001, that are of greater advantage will apply.  It is the intention of the Board to be as fair and encouraging to the show going membership as possible, and by this temporary adjustment give sufficient time for notification and understanding to spread throughout the membership.  If you or anyone you know has questions or comments, please feel free to contact any Board member and share your question or comment.
